Right here are some standards to bear in mind as you fix these problems: Now is the time to start timing yourself. Preferably, you should not invest more than 2030 minutes addressing any kind of offered problem. (This probably won't be feasible for all questions right now.)Don't be inhibited if you are not able to resolve an issue within the assigned time.
This will aid you build the self-confidence that you can address it and then you can concentrate on fixing them quicker later. Begin thinking of the Runtime and Memory intricacy of each remedy. You will certainly have to verbalize the intricacies in the actual meeting plainly, so it's better to begin currently.
You will certainly need to spend 23 weeks right here. Do not worry if you hit obstacles and obtain stuck typically you will obtain the hang of it eventually. Trust fund me, concerns that look difficult in the initial couple of days start to seem simple after you've had method. This is the one that numerous believe will not matter, although this is the interview that sometimes matters the most.
Firms try not to hire people that can be toxic the lasting cost of doing so can be enormous. Firms additionally don't want to employ engineers that are not enthusiastic regarding the item. Cultural fit interviews are there to weed out such individuals. Some of the standard rules of Social fit meetings are:1.
(I when had a prospect that informed me that Facebook markets cloud solutions like AWS (Storage/Compute). He had even made use of one of those. Now, Facebook did buy and kept it alive for a while, yet Cloud Infrastructure was never Facebook's primary/core service).2. Be ready to explain circumstances where you had a problem with your colleagues or supervisors and how you fixed it.
3. Speak about what you intend to achieve in the company4. Talk regarding some of your current/ most significant accomplishments as an engineer5. Speak about some especially crazy/difficult pests that you encountered.
